WebOxalis, genus of small herbaceous plants, in the family Oxalidaceae, comprising about 850 species, native primarily to southern Africa and tropical and South America. WebLe genre Oxalis (en français, les oxalis, terme masculin ou féminin, ou oxalides) regroupe plusieurs espèces de plantes herbacées de la famille des Oxalidacées, vivaces, basses, le … WebLe genre Oxalis (en français, les oxalis, terme masculin ou féminin, ou oxalides) regroupe plusieurs espèces de plantes herbacées de la famille des Oxalidacées, vivaces, basses, le plus souvent rampantes. On les reconnaît à leurs feuilles trifoliées, chaque foliole ayant la forme d'un cœur dont la pointe est constituée par le pétiolule .
